    Click in for the world premiere of Everything but the Girl’s final single before their feverishly anticipated new album, Fuse, drops this Friday (Apr. 21). “No One Knows We’re Dancing,” changes the pace a bit from the dance-forward singles we’ve gotten from Fuse so far. While the song itself is an ode to band member Ben Watt’s time DJ-ing day parties in West London, the atmosphere it provides is contemplative and lush. It takes its time to present character studies of the types that find their community on the same dance floors week after week after week, eventually coming to “know everybody’s name.” Stylistically it feels like something of a bridge between the group’s keenly observed, early-era acoustic sounds, and the genre-defining electro they’ve offered up since the mid-90’s. We are officially counting down the seconds until we have the full album in our hot little hands.

    The rest of today’s MBE is similarly reflective, and action packed. You’ll hear plenty of sonic nods to the influential percussion style of Azymuth’s Ivan "Mamão" Conti, as the founding member of the famed Brazilian jazz-funk trio died recently at the age of 76. We’re also getting into the mood for the upcoming season at the Ford Theater with a cut from serpentwithfeet who will be bringing “Heart of Brick” to the storied venue in October. The stacked line-up for the full season — which includes KCRW staples Mac DeMarco, José James, Thee Sacred Souls, Hermanos Guitierrez and Arooj Aftab, Vijay Iyer, Shahzad Ismaily (performing together for the first time as a trio) — can be found here.
